Why Are Heat Pump Dryers Gaining Popularity?
From my experience, heat pump dryers are revolutionizing the way we dry clothes. Unlike traditional vented dryers, they use refrigerant technology to extract moisture, which means they operate at lower temperatures and consume less energy. I was initially skeptical, but after testing one, I noticed significant savings on my electricity bill and a gentler drying process on my fabrics. This aligns with recent reports from authoritative sources that highlight their efficiency benefits.
Gas Dryers: Still Relevant in 2024?
While electric dryers get a lot of attention, I realized that gas dryers remain a strong contender for eco-conscious households. They heat faster than electric models and often have lower operational costs, especially if your home already has a gas line. I appreciate the quick drying times, which are perfect for busy mornings. Plus, modern gas dryers come with smart features that optimize energy use, making them a smart choice for those aiming to reduce their carbon footprint while maintaining efficiency.

Harnessing the Power of Eco-Friendly Refrigerants in Modern Dryers
One of the most compelling advancements I’ve observed in recent years is the shift towards environmentally conscious refrigerants used in heat pump dryers. Unlike traditional refrigerants, which have historically been associated with ozone depletion and high global warming potential, newer formulations such as R-134a alternatives and natural refrigerants like hydrocarbon blends are making a significant impact. These innovations not only improve energy efficiency but also align with a broader commitment to sustainability. Industry reports from the Department of Energy highlight how this transition is vital for reducing our carbon footprint.
